Transaction 166aa0faac251eaf7293c6e3649dce96404ad3020f113b987466cd6c8d6abd16
3 Input
2 Outputs
- 166aa0faac251eaf7293c6e3649dce96404ad3020f113b987466cd6c8d6abd16:0
- 166aa0faac251eaf7293c6e3649dce96404ad3020f113b987466cd6c8d6abd16:1
value 4009119
address 3MXSVdFKU6aVCDjANNsCUeiR9iGhTD1mhg
value 2153076
address 1CV772htJUYRs1rhdYWLzYcvUGtWfMu2gg